Cam Skattebo is getting some Heisman buzz, despite the fact that the award was handed out a few weeks ago.
The Arizona State running back put the team on his back during the Big 12 championship game, and he did it again on Wednesday during the Peach Bowl against Texas. Skattebo threw for a touchdown, rushed for a touchdown and hauled in a 63-yard touchdown reception to get the Sun Devils back into the game, despite trailing 24-8 with less than 10 minutes remaining in the 4th quarter.
Now, with the game heading to overtime, Skattebo is going to have a chance to lead his team to the national semifinals. Whether or not he can do it is only slightly relevant: Skattebo has earned his flowers today, and he’s causing quite the storm online.
Fans on social media came to his defense during the late stages of the game. After not even being named a Heisman finalist, some fans want to retroactively give Skattebo the award instead of Colorado’s Travis Hunter.
